Parasite virulence when the infection reduces the host immune response.
2010
Parasite infections often induce a reduction in host immune response either because of a direct manipulation of the immune system by the parasite or because of energy depletion. Although infection-induced immunodepression can favour the establishment of the parasite within the host, a too severe immunodepression may increase the risk of infection with opportunistic pathogens, stopping the period over which the parasite can be transmitted to other hosts. Here, we explore how the risk of contracting opportunistic diseases affects the survival of the amphipod Gammarus pulex infected by the acanthocephalan Pomphorhynchus laevis . Macrophage inhibiting activity in serum and central lymph of Listeria-immune mice.
1975
Serum and central lymph from mice immunized with live Listeria monocytogenes six days previously and boostered four hours before collection exerted significant inhibition of macrophage migration in vitro. It is concluded that lymphokines or lymphokine-like products of the cellular immune reaction are released in vivo and are possibly instrumental in the generation of acquired cellular antibacterial immunity.
Is there a role for antioxidant carotenoids in limiting self-harming immune response in invertebrates?
2007
Innate immunity relies on effectors, which produce cytotoxic molecules that have not only the advantage of killing pathogens but also the disadvantage of harming host tissues and organs. Although the role of dietary antioxidants in invertebrate immunity is still unknown, it has been shown in vertebrates that carotenoids scavenge cytotoxic radicals generated during the immune response. Carotenoids may consequently decrease the self-harming cost of immunity. A positive relationship between the levels of innate immune defence and circulating carotenoid might therefore be expected. Association of SUMO4 M55V polymorphism with autoimmune diabetes in Latvian patients.
2006
Small ubiquitin-related modifier (SUMO4), located in IDDM5, has been identified as a potential susceptibility gene for type 1 diabetes mellitus (T1DM). The novel polymorphism M55V, causing an amino acid change in the evolutionarily conserved met55 residue has been shown to activate the nuclear factor kappaB (NF-kappaB), hence the suspected role of SUMO4 in the pathogenicity of T1DM. The M55V polymorphism has been shown to be associated with susceptibility to T1DM in Asians, but not in Caucasians. Expression of thrombospondin-1 in pancreatic carcinoma: correlation with microvessel density.
2001
Thrombospondin-1 (TSP-1) is a multifunctional platelet and extracellular matrix protein that is involved in angiogenesis. Under certain pathological conditions, e.g., malignant tumors, high concentrations of TSP-1 work as an angiogenic agonist. Here we examined 98 pancreatic carcinomas with respect to TSP-1 immunoreactivity and its correlation to intratumoral microvessel density (MVD), a representation of the overall degree of angiogenesis in carcinomas. Northern blot analysis for TSP-1 mRNA was performed in seven additional cases. Tumor Necrosis Factor-α Allele 2 Shows an Association with Insulin-Dependent Diabetes Mellitus in Latvians
2006
Insulin-dependent diabetes mellitus (IDDM) is one of the most common chronic diseases. It is an autoimmune disease. Genes contributing the most for development of IDDM are located on chromosome 6p21.3 in the region called the major histocompatibility complex (MHC). HLA-DQ8/DR4 and DQ2/DR3 have shown positive association with IDDM, while DQ6 has negative association with IDDM in most Caucasian populations. The location of the tumor necrosis factor alpha (TNF-alpha) gene in the MHC suggests the role of TNF in the etiology of IDDM as an autoimmune disease.
